The release - 10/10/2018

"The Thomas More Society filed suit today against EBSCO, a nationwide
corporation that imbeds pornography in databases it markets to schools
for use by unsuspecting school children for their homework and
research. In the same suit, the Thomas More Society also sued the
Colorado Library Consortium, a tax-supported nonprofit corporation
that knowingly brokers EBSCO's pornographic databases to schools and
libraries throughout Colorado."
